Upstate Elevator Supply Co., a company that makes ingestible, beverage, pet, and topical products, opened its new CBD-focused manufacturing facility in Burlington, Vermont. The facility is fully compliant with Current Good Manufacturing Practice regulations.

According to company officials, the team worked with the Vermont Department of Health and the Vermont Manufacturing Extension Center on the buildout to perfect quality control systems and to ensure the facility adheres to all food safety requirements set forth by the State of Vermont.
